Administrative Action Taken in Regard to Samples Reported to be NOT GENUINE

Sample No.ArticleNature of Adulteration and/or irregularityAction Taken
(a) In respect of normal sampling
68Pork Luncheon SausageContained meat 54%. Pork sausages of any kind should contain at least 65% of meat.Manufacturer informed of the result of analysis and also of the coming into force in near future of regulations stipulating the minimum meat content for this type of sausage.
82Beetroot, BottledContained an artificial colouring matter, Red 10B, the presence of which was not disclosed in the statement of ingredients.Manufacturer informed of infringement and requested to amend the label on the product to include the colouring referred to by the Public Analyst.
103 104 105 106 107 108Instant Low-fat Milk, SkimmedEach sample consisted of Dried Skimmed Milk and respectively contained-mois-ture 6.2%, 14.2%, 6.1%, 6.4%, 6.3% and 7.5%. By Regulation 4 of the Dried Milk Regulations, 1965, this article should not contain more than 5% of moisture. The solubility of each sample was respectively 99.8%, 75%, 99.9%, 99.6%, 99.7% and 99.8%. In the Public Analyst's opinion the solubility of 75% in respect of sample No. 104 was so low as to render it unsuitable for ordinary use.Manufacturer informed of Public Analyst's findings and has surrendered the remainder of the stock from which samples were taken.
